BROOK PARK, Ohio – A Brookdale Avenue resident called police at about 5 p.m. Sept. 12 and said that a 36-year-old Cleveland man he knew jumped his backyard fence, entered his yard and tried to open the rear sliding-glass door to his house.

The resident said the Cleveland man was demanding money the resident owed him. The resident told the man he didn’t have the money he owed.

The resident managed to hold the sliding glass door shut so that the man couldn’t enter his house. The man threatened to return that night and kill the resident. Then the man drove away.

The resident gave police photographs of the man he took as the man was leaving. Police identified the man by comparing his Ohio Bureau of Motor Vehicles photo with the photos the resident provided.
